    Lxkilla?????

    Driving to & from the Bank today, I passed a Acura RSX with a personilized plate reading LXKILLA!!

    Although I have never tangled with this car, the official specs say that it will do 0-60 in 6.2 sec. & 14.90 in the quarter mile. This car looked totally stock, right out of the showroom..

    So is this guy delusional?

    Or am I missing something?

    I don't think a Charger is much lighter than a Magnum, being is the same car with different body panels. Dodge reports the RT RWD Charger at 4031lb. & Magnum RT RWD at 4125, a diff of 94lbs.
